Oral Versus Parenteral Antibiotics for Osteoarticular Infections: You PICC.
A previously healthy 8-year-old girl presented to the emergency department with right hip pain and inability to bear weight on the right lower extremity. She had been afebrile at home, although was receiving ibuprofen for pain. متن کاملRisks and complications of prolonged parenteral antibiotic treatment in children with acute osteoarticular infections.
This study aimed at assessing the prevalence of complications encountered during prolonged intravenous antibiotic (AB) therapy when treating acute osteoarticular (OA) infections in children. متن کاملAcute bacterial osteoarticular infections: eight-year analysis of C-reactive protein for oral step-down therapy.
BACKGROUND One of the most important decisions in the treatment of osteoarticular infections is the time at which parenteral therapy can be changed to oral therapy. C-reactive protein (CRP) is an acute inflammatory indicator with a half-life of 19 hours and thus can be helpful in assessing the adequacy of therapy for bacterial infections.
